## Configuration

The Ledgerline exporter was migrated from fixed-width to the new columnar payroll format in release 4.2. All format toggles live in `.env`, which must never be committed. `EXPORT_FORMAT` should read `columnar-v2`, and `ROUNDING_MODE` must stay `banker` for audit parity. Validation runs at startup and rejects unknown keys. The final entry sets the payroll vault secret, on the line below.

env line for fafof-fahag: LEDGER_TOKEN5=f8790

## Environments: Thistledown Report Builder

Thistledown runs in three environments: dev, staging, and production. A subtle difference matters for sorting stability — dev uses an in-memory sort that is stable, while production's distributed sort was not until release 12, when stable tie-breaking by row id became the default everywhere. Maintainers should verify this flag is identical across environments before comparing report output. Each environment loads the following configuration values.

deployment values, bagag-bawig:
DRUVAN_PIN=0740
DRUVAN_TENANT=wendor
DRUVAN_METRICS_HOST=metrics.druvan.tolvaqnet.example
DRUVAN_SEAL=seal_75cd0b2d
DRUVAN_STANDBY_TEAM=tamael

So, the svc-foxhollow service account occasionally hits flaky DNS when resolving the internal Burrowcache endpoint — lookups time out maybe one in fifty tries, mostly after pod restarts. Until the resolver fix lands, the workaround is to enable the retry shim in the account's config and bump the TTL override to 30 seconds. You'll need to authenticate to the Burrowcache admin plane to apply that, and the service account's internal key is pasted just below.

API key for yahig-tadup: kto7_ubizbYm

# Constants for Squatwatch, our typo-squatting package scanner.
# Compares new registry uploads against the Fernbury allowlist using
# edit distance and download-count deltas. False positives page the
# on-call, so thresholds are deliberately conservative. Bump scan
# concurrency only if the registry mirror is healthy. Tuning values
# currently in effect are:

tuning constants:
TIERS = {
    "sorion": 670,
    "istax": 547,
}